    China suspends ‘special port fees’ on US vessels

    BEIJING: China mentioned on Monday (Nov 10) it might droop for one yr “particular port charges” on US vessels “concurrently” with Washington’s pause on levies concentrating on Chinese language ships, as a fragile commerce truce between the superpowers continues to take form.

    America and China have been concerned in a unstable commerce and tariff conflict for months, however agreed to stroll again some punitive measures after presidents Xi Jinping and Donald Trump met final month in South Korea.

    At one level, duties on either side had reached prohibitive triple-digit ranges, hampering commerce between the world’s two largest economies and snarling world provide chains.

    The suspension of the port charges, which utilized to ships operated by or inbuilt the US that visited Chinese language ports, started at 1.01pm (5.01am GMT) on Monday, a transport ministry assertion mentioned.

    The US shipbuilding trade was dominant after World Conflict II however has steadily declined and now accounts for simply 0.1 per cent of world output.

    The sector is now dominated by Asia, with China constructing almost half of all ships launched, forward of South Korea and Japan.

    Individually, Beijing mentioned it might droop sanctions against US subsidiaries of Hanwha Ocean, certainly one of South Korea’s largest shipbuilders.

    The year-long suspension of measures towards Hanwha, efficient from Nov 10, was linked to the US halting port charges it had levied on Chinese language-built and operated ships, China’s commerce ministry mentioned in an internet assertion.

    “In gentle of this (US suspension) … China has determined to droop the related measures” for one yr, it mentioned.

    China had imposed sanctions on 5 US subsidiaries of Hanwha in October, accusing them of supporting a US authorities “Part 301” investigation that discovered Beijing’s dominance of the shipbuilding trade unreasonable.

    Organisations and people in China had been banned from cooperating with Hanwha Transport LLC, Hanwha Philly Shipyard Inc, Hanwha Ocean USA Worldwide LLC, Hanwha Transport Holdings LLC and HS USA Holdings Corp.

    A deliberate probe into whether or not the Part 301 investigation impacted the “safety and growth pursuits” of China’s shipbuilding trade and provide chain had additionally been shelved for one yr, in accordance with the transport ministry.
